bebe stores, inc. (OTCMKTS:BDST –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ant increase in short interest in August. As of August 31st, there was short interest totaling 1,140 shares, an increase of 411.2% from the August 15th total of 223 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 2,997 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 0.4 days. Currently, 0.0% of the shares of the stock are sold short.
bebe stores Stock Performance
Shares of BDST opened at $0.55 on Friday. The company’s fifty day moving average is $0.49 and its 200 day moving average is $0.38. bebe stores has a fifty-two week low of $0.17 and a fifty-two week high of $0.60.
bebe stores Company Profile
bebe stores inc is an American retailer specializing in contemporary women’s fashion. The company designs, sources and sells an assortment of apparel, including dresses, tops, denim, outerwear and accessories. The brand caters to a youthful demographic seeking modern silhouettes and trend-driven styles. Distribution channels include direct-to-consumer e-commerce, as well as wholesale partnerships and international licensed operations.
Founded in 1976 by fashion entrepreneur Manny Mashouf and headquartered in San Francisco, bebe initially expanded through specialty retail stores across the United States.
